As V8’s were making their way on the brand’s saloon range due to demand overseas, the successors of the famed ‘Pagoda’ SL’s were outfitted with the newer 3.5 and 4.5-litre powerplants from the W109 and W111. Built on Mercedes’ tradition of engineering excellence, these engines soon proved to be robust, torquey and reliable, and were eventually developed into 4.2, 5.0 and 5.6-litre variants.
